Country and urban gardens, large and small, can benefit from the great variety of evergreen and deciduous shrubs that are now widely available. At Wych Cross we have a vast range to choose from with particular attention on those that will thrive in our local acid soil.
Alpines are not one of our 'specialties' but we have good stocks of many different plants and our customers keep coming back for them.
Many people expect Ashdown Forest to be predominantly woodland, whereas it is now, as it has always been, predominantly heathland. But there is no shortage of trees for sale at Wych Cross where we have a larger than average selection.
Herbaceous plants generally have enjoyed a massive resurgence in popularity in recent years, which is reflected in the choice we have available all the year round, but especially from April onwards.
At Wych Cross we have a 4000 sq ft showroom dedicated to the display of best quality wooden and cane furniture. Our main range consists of the entire Alexander Rose collection, and we are also stockists for Barlow Tyrie. Alexander Rose:
Alexander Rose offers a superb range of Teak and Iroko garden furniture. It is designed in England and is the market leader in the field Mortise and tenon joints are extensively used throughout the range, also solid brass fittings and hardware are generously used to further enhance the strength and appearance.
